How to Sell Your Amazon Business: A Comprehensive Guide

Sell Your Amazon Business

Selling an Amazon business is a significant decision that requires careful planning and strategic thinking. Whether it’s due to a desire to capitalize on your investment or a shift in business focus, understanding the process and considerations for selling your Amazon business is crucial. This guide provides a comprehensive overview of the steps and factors involved in successfully selling an Amazon business.

Understanding the Value of Your Amazon Business

 

The value of an Amazon business is determined by several factors, including its financial performance (revenue and profitability), brand strength, customer base, product portfolio, and growth potential. Before listing your business for sale, it’s important to conduct a thorough valuation to understand its worth.

Preparing for the Sale


Financial Records and Documentation

Ensure that all your financial records are accurate and up-to-date. This includes sales data, expenses, profit margins, and any other relevant financial information. Proper documentation is crucial for potential buyers to assess the health and potential of the business.

Streamlining Operations

A business that operates smoothly and has efficient systems in place is more attractive to buyers. Streamline your operations, including inventory management, supplier relationships, and fulfillment processes.

Securing Intellectual Property

If your business has any intellectual property (IP), such as trademarks or patents, make sure these are secured and properly documented. IP can significantly increase the value of your business.

Enhancing Your Business’s Appeal

Improve your business’s appeal by optimizing your Amazon listings, addressing any customer service issues, and ensuring a positive seller reputation. A business with a strong track record and good standing on Amazon is more likely to attract serious buyers.

Choosing a Selling Platform

There are several platforms and services where you can list your Amazon business for sale, including business brokerage firms, online marketplaces specializing in e-commerce businesses, and private sales through industry contacts. Each platform has its pros and cons, so choose one that aligns with your business type and sale objectives.

The Sales Process


Valuation and Listing

After valuing your business, create a comprehensive listing that highlights its strengths and potential. This should include detailed information about your financials, operations, customer base, and growth opportunities.

Negotiating with Potential Buyers

Be prepared for negotiations with potential buyers. This may involve discussing the sale price, terms of the sale, and any post-sale support you might provide.

Due Diligence

Potential buyers will conduct due diligence to verify the information you’ve provided. Be transparent and cooperative during this process to maintain trust and credibility.

Closing the Sale

Once you reach an agreement with a buyer, the final step is the closing process. This typically involves legal and financial transactions to transfer ownership of the business.

Post-Sale Considerations

Consider any post-sale obligations you may have, such as training the new owner or providing support during the transition period. Clear agreements on these matters should be part of the sale process.

Concluding Analysis


Selling an Amazon business can be a complex process, but with careful preparation, accurate valuation, and strategic marketing, you can successfully transition your business to a new owner. Ensure that you understand the legal and financial implications of the sale and seek professional advice as needed to navigate this process effectively.
